Linux服務(wù)器時(shí)間命令參考指南
Linux服務(wù)器時(shí)間命令是指在Linux操作系統中,用來(lái)設置和管理服務(wù)器時(shí)間的命令集合。這些命令可以讓服務(wù)器的時(shí)間準確無(wú)誤,并且對于維護服務(wù)器的正常運行非常重要。本文將從四個(gè)方面詳細闡述Linux服務(wù)器時(shí)間命令參考指南,為您介紹如何使用這些命令來(lái)管理服務(wù)器時(shí)間。
1、時(shí)間管理基礎
在使用Linux服務(wù)器時(shí)間命令之前,了解時(shí)間管理基礎是非常重要的。Linux服務(wù)器時(shí)間系統由兩個(gè)部分組成:硬件時(shí)鐘和系統時(shí)鐘。硬件時(shí)鐘是由服務(wù)器的BIOS系統維護的實(shí)時(shí)鐘表,它記錄了硬件設備自上次斷電后所經(jīng)過(guò)的時(shí)間。而系統時(shí)鐘則是由操作系統內核維護的,它表示的是從系統啟動(dòng)開(kāi)始到現在的時(shí)間。在Linux服務(wù)器中,系統時(shí)間可以由多個(gè)命令來(lái)管理,包括date、hwclock、timedatectl等。date命令用于顯示或設置系統時(shí)間,hwclock命令用于顯示或設置硬件時(shí)鐘,timedatectl命令可以用于調整時(shí)區和NTP服務(wù)器。
當Linux服務(wù)器啟動(dòng)時(shí),它會(huì )從硬件時(shí)鐘中讀取時(shí)間,然后將這個(gè)時(shí)間加載到系統時(shí)鐘中。如果你需要更改服務(wù)器的時(shí)間,可以使用date命令直接修改系統時(shí)間。如果你需要更改硬件時(shí)鐘,可以使用hwclock向BIOS系統發(fā)送命令,以確保硬件時(shí)鐘與系統時(shí)鐘同步。
2、使用date命令管理時(shí)間
date命令是Linux服務(wù)器時(shí)間命令集中最常用的命令之一。它可以用于顯示或設置服務(wù)器的日期和時(shí)間。以下是一些date命令的使用示例:1. 顯示當前系統時(shí)間:date
2. 顯示指定格式的時(shí)間:date "+%Y-%m-%d %H:%M:%S"
3. 設置系統時(shí)間:date -s "2022-02-22 22:22:22"
可以看到,date命令簡(jiǎn)單易用,適用于大多數時(shí)間管理需求。當需要將系統時(shí)間設置為一個(gè)特定的值時(shí),date命令會(huì )非常有用。同時(shí),date命令還可以用于顯示不同時(shí)區的時(shí)間,以及執行時(shí)間計算等操作。
3、使用hwclock命令管理時(shí)間
hwclock命令是Linux服務(wù)器時(shí)間命令集中另一個(gè)常用命令。它用于設置或顯示硬件時(shí)鐘的內容,并且可以與系統時(shí)鐘進(jìn)行同步。以下是一些hwclock命令的使用示例:1. 顯示硬件時(shí)鐘:hwclock
2. 顯示硬件時(shí)鐘的時(shí)間戳:hwclock --getepoch
3. 將系統時(shí)鐘同步到硬件時(shí)鐘:hwclock --systohc
hwclock命令可以確保硬件時(shí)鐘與系統時(shí)鐘同步,并且可以在電源斷電時(shí)保持時(shí)間的準確性。如果硬件時(shí)鐘與系統時(shí)鐘不同步,可能導致系統啟動(dòng)時(shí)出現各種問(wèn)題。
4、使用timedatectl命令管理時(shí)間
timedatectl命令是Linux服務(wù)器時(shí)間命令集中一個(gè)比較新的命令。它可以設置時(shí)區和NTP服務(wù)器,并且可以用于顯示系統時(shí)間和硬件時(shí)鐘的狀態(tài)。以下是一些timedatectl命令的使用示例:1. 顯示系統時(shí)區:timedatectl
2. 設置時(shí)區為北京時(shí)間:timedatectl set-timezone Asia/Shanghai
3. 啟用NTP同步:timedatectl set-ntp true
timedatectl命令對于需要在Linux服務(wù)器上進(jìn)行多方面時(shí)間管理的用戶(hù)和管理員來(lái)說(shuō)非常有用。比如,如果你需要考慮到跨時(shí)區的用戶(hù),你可以使用timedatectl來(lái)設置正確的時(shí)區。如果你需要確保服務(wù)器的時(shí)間是準確同步的,你可以使用timedatectl啟用NTP同步功能。
總結:
本文介紹了Linux服務(wù)器時(shí)間命令參考指南,并從四個(gè)方面詳細闡述了這些命令的使用。首先介紹了時(shí)間管理基礎,確保讀者能夠理解Linux服務(wù)器時(shí)間系統的基本概念。然后分別介紹了date、hwclock、timedatectl命令,以及它們的使用示例。通過(guò)本文的介紹,讀者應該能夠掌握如何使用這些命令來(lái)管理Linux服務(wù)器的時(shí)間。